Legendary filmmaker Singeetham Srinivasa Rao returned to direction with the musical comedy fantasy, Sing Geetham, at the age of 94. The film which was released on June 12, and produced by Nag Ashwin, received positive responses and appreciation from audiences and celebrities. Shalini Kondepudi, Ahilya, and Ayaan played the lead roles in Sing Geetham.
Several film personalities, including top actors Kamal Haasan, Chiranjeevi, and many others, supported the film and appreciated Singeetham Srinivasa Rao for making a film at the age of 94. The story of Sing Geetham revolves around a village named Kuberapuram, which has gold mines. The villagers want to become rich by selling the gold mines, but a young girl opposes their decision and fights to protect the trees. She later gets support from a young man, and the story takes an interesting turn after a curse from the local deity forces the villagers to communicate through songs instead of normal conversations.
